Introduction.- 1.1 General Concepts of Selective Photophysics and Photochemistry.- 1.2 Classification of Selective Molecular Photoprocesses Induced by Laser Radiation.- 1.3 Selectivity and Yields of Photochemical Processes.- 1.4 Applications of Selective Laser Photochemistry.- 2. Selective Photoexcitation of Atoms and Molecules.- 2.1 Isotopic Selectivity in Linear Photoexcitation of Atoms and Molecules.- 2.2 Limitations of Linear Selectivity of Photoexcitation and Methods for Its Enhancement.- 2.3 Methods for the Enhancement of Selectivity with Nonlinear Photoexcitation.- 2.4 Overall Selectivity of Photochemical Processes.- 3. Multi-Step Selective Photoionization of Atoms.- 3.1 Introduction.- 3.2 Characteristics of Multi-Step Photoionization.- 3.3 Photoionization from Excited States to the Continuum and Autoionization States.- 3.4 Ionization of Highly Excited (Rydberg) Atomic States.- 3.5 Collision Processes in the Multi-Step Ionization of Atoms.- 4. Selective Monomolecular Photoprocesses with Nonlinear Excitation of Electronic States.- 4.1 Methods Used in the Multi-Step Excitation of Molecular Electronic States.- 4.2 Photodissociation of Molecules by Two-Step Excitation Through Vibrational States.- 4.3 Monomolecular Photoprocesses with Multi-Photon Vibrational and Subsequent Electronic Excitation.- 4.4 Photoionization of Molecules Through Nonlinear Excitation of Electronic States.- 5. Multi-Photon Monomolecular Photoprocesses in the Ground Electronic State.- 5.1 Introduction to IR Multi-Photon Laser Chemistry.- 5.2 Multi-Photon (MP) Absorption of IR Radiation and Excitation of Molecules Through Lower Vibrational Levels.- 5.3 Multi-Photon Excitation of Molecules in the Vibrational Quasi-Continuum and Distribution of Vibrational Energy.- 5.4 Dissociation of Highly Excited Molecules.- 5.5 Molecular Isomerization under MP Excitation.- 5.6 Isotopic Selectivity of the MP Dissociation.- 6. Laser Photoseparation on an Atomic and a Molecular Level.- 6.1 Introduction to Methods of Laser Photoseparation.- 6.2 Separation of Atoms Through Photoionization.- 6.3 Separation of Molecules Through Photodissociation.- 7. Selective Laser Detection of Atoms and Molecules.- 7.1 Detection of Single Atoms by Selective Multi-Step Photoionization.- 7.2 Detection of Molecules by Selective Photoionization and Mass Spectrometry.- 7.3 Laser Photoionization Visualization of Molecules and Spatial Localization of Molecular Bonds.- 8. Laser Photochemistry and Photobiochemistry.- 8.1 IR Multi-Photon Photochemistry.- 8.2 Nonlinear Photochemistry of Biomolecules in Solution.- Main Notations.- References.- Additional Reading.
